The Cobblewick site builder (Fenrow stack) only rebuilds pages whose content hash changed. Hashes live in the .fenrow/manifest file; never commit it. Triggers: content merge to main, or manual via `fenrow rebuild --changed`. Full rebuilds are Sundays only — they take forty minutes and evict the CDN cache. If the manifest corrupts, restore it from the Larchgate snapshot bucket before rebuilding, or you'll republish everything. Snapshot restores require unlocking the ops vault, which accepts the recovery passphrase below.

unlock words, fahog-kahag: sorix-lamath-oliax-quenok-caswyn-wenys-istmir-wenir-weneth-juldor-ulaax-fraax-praiel-jorix

TICKET #—Locked Vault Blocking Flaky Test Triage (Pennyledger Payments)

The integration suite for Pennyledger's settlement service keeps flaking because the secrets vault sealed itself after three failed token fetches during last night's run. Plugin authors cannot re-run contract tests until the vault is unsealed, since mock gateway credentials live inside it. Please do not retry blindly — each failed attempt extends the lockout window. To unseal manually from the ops shell, authenticate with the recovery passphrase below.

strongbox words: fraath-isteth

**Action item (Quillmark i18n outage, owner: Tamsin R.)**

The extraction script in `strtrawl` silently dropped pluralized keys when the source tree exceeded its file-count ceiling, which is how the Pelverton release shipped with missing German strings. We will add a hard failure instead of truncation, plus a count assertion against the previous run. For the sync: the limits that caused the truncation were never reviewed after the repo doubled in size. They are reproduced below for discussion.

tuning constants:
QUOTAS = {
    "druwyn": 5,
    "holix": 5,
    "zorath": 5,
    "holwyn": 10,
}

Investigation shows the resolver-edge nodes were re-imaged by the Tavrin provisioning pipeline but did not receive the updated search-domain ordering, so they drift from what the config repository declares. Restarting the caching daemon masks the issue for a few hours. Future maintainers should verify node state against the declared baseline before debugging further. The intended settings for each edge node are as follows.

deployment values, kajef-fahip:
druwyn:
  pin: 0722
  metrics_host: metrics.druwyn.zemvarsys.internal
  tenant: juldor
  seal: seal_6ddf1794